What fencing materials work best given Falls City's moderate termite risk and soil corrosivity?

Material compatibility is key. For wood, use pressure-treated lumber rated for ground contact. All metal fasteners and hardware must be hot-dip galvanized to prevent rust streaks from moderate soil corrosion. Composite materials are a viable, low-maintenance alternative that resists both decay and insects.

What is required for utility locating and permitting before a fence installation?

You must call Oregon 811 at least two business days before digging. Hitting a gas, water, or fiber line in Falls City Central is a major liability with fines and repair costs. A professional installer manages the utility locate ticket and coordinates with the City permit office to ensure all paperwork is current and on-site.
